Output 599e157a682f95b0a5ef3d00e4abaf33d66ee4a224a5ed2a30931cdfe2f908ed:30

value
650097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bef4b4995c0797d262bcccc168f20d78916c28a5 OP_EQUAL
address
3K6hTRd2h72c83RAdj4gggLxPMRTvwcB4P
transaction
599e157a682f95b0a5ef3d00e4abaf33d66ee4a224a5ed2a30931cdfe2f908ed
spent
true